Key Headlines Impacting Copart
Here are the key news stories impacting Copart this week:
- Positive Sentiment: Copart beat Q3 expectations, reporting $0.43 EPS versus $0.41 expected and revenue of $1.24 billion versus $1.19 billion expected, signaling that pricing and mix improvements are supporting results. Article: Copart, Inc. (CPRT) Tops Q3 Earnings and Revenue Estimates
- Positive Sentiment: Analysts highlighted strong selling prices, a richer revenue mix, and pricing power on the earnings call, suggesting Copart is offsetting lower unit volumes with better monetization. Article: Copart Earnings Call Highlights Pricing Power And Growth
- Positive Sentiment: Coverage noted that international expansion and a diversified seller base are helping offset U.S. insurance pressures, pointing to a more resilient growth profile. Article: CPRT Q1 deep dive: International expansion and diversified seller base offset US insurance pressures

Copart Profile
Copart (NASDAQ: CPRT) is a global provider of online vehicle auction and remarketing services, focused primarily on the sale of salvage and clean-title vehicles. The company operates a technology-driven auction platform that connects sellers — including insurance companies, vehicle finance firms, rental car companies, dealerships and fleet owners — with a broad buyer base consisting of vehicle dismantlers, recyclers, rebuilders and retail buyers. Copart’s business model centers on efficient vehicle disposition using digital bidding and logistics services to maximize recovery value for its clients.
Core services include hosting live and timed online auctions, vehicle listing and inspection support, title processing, and transportation and storage solutions.
